The PDF file contains embedded JavaScript, including a high-severity 'eval()' call, indicating an attempt to execute arbitrary code. The ML classifier also flagged this PDF as malicious with high confidence. The presence of JavaScript and the eval() function strongly suggest the document is designed to download and execute a secondary payload, a common technique for malware delivery.

  • Additional-actions dictionary low PDF_AA
    PDF defines /AA (Additional Actions) that references an executable action (JS/JavaScript/Launch/SubmitForm) — can auto-trigger on document or widget events. Form-field calc/format/validate/keystroke handlers in legitimate interactive forms commonly fire this, so it is reported as a low-weight signal; weaponised auto-execution is flagged by stronger rules (PDF_OPENACTION, encrypted-with-JS, etc.)
